In case of confusion -

Wanker is a term that literally means "one who wanks (masturbates)" but has since become a general insult. It is a pejorative term of English origin common in Britain and other parts of the English-speaking world, including Ireland, Australia and New Zealand. It initially referred to an "onanist" and is synonymous with the word tosser.

To the majority of English-speaking Americans, the word 'fanny' means about the same as 'butt', as in 'fanny-pack'.

Here in UK the word 'fanny' means a lady's personal parts.

Same goes for 'shag' - a kind of dance. In the UK it is a verb, meanly to engage in a very rough f*ck/sexual intercourse. Unless it is being used to refer to a kind of carpet - as in 'shag-pile' meaning shaggy.
